The SMBJ64CA M4G belongs to the category of transient voltage suppressor diodes (TVS diodes) and is commonly used for surge protection in electronic circuits. These diodes are characterized by their fast response time, low clamping voltage, and high surge current capability. The SMBJ64CA M4G is typically packaged in a surface mount DO-214AA (SMB) package and is available in tape and reel packaging with a quantity of 3000 units per reel.
The SMBJ64CA M4G follows the standard pin configuration for SMB diodes, with two pins for connection to the circuit board. The anode is typically connected to the positive side of the circuit, while the cathode is connected to the ground or negative side.
When a transient voltage spike occurs in the circuit, the SMBJ64CA M4G rapidly conducts, diverting the excess energy away from the sensitive components. This action helps to limit the voltage across the circuit, protecting it from damage due to overvoltage events.
The SMBJ64CA M4G is widely used in various electronic devices and systems, including: - Power supplies - Communication equipment - Industrial control systems - Automotive electronics - Consumer electronics
